Job Summary Tired of the usual practice model? Ready for something that actually fits therapists who think and work differently?

At the Black Sheep Therapy Collective, we're building a home for independent, depth-oriented clinicians who value autonomy, clinical integrity, and real support.

Two clear paths: Join the team as a contractor — Start at a minimum of 70% of collected fees. We handle the systems so you can focus on the work. Stay fully independent — Keep your own credentialing and simply lease office space weekly. Prefer we handle your independent credentialing for you? We will. Right now we have enough clients on our waiting list to fill two therapist caseloads. The work is here. The space is ready (it's really nice ). The model is flexible.

We're looking for clinicians drawn to deeper work — IFS, Jungian, somatic, attachment, and related approaches — who want a collaborative environment without giving up their independence.

If you're ready to try something different, reach out. Virtual positions also available. Qualifications Master's degree or higher in social work, psychology, counseling, or related field; licensure or certification as required by state law for mental health practitioners. Proven experience working with a wide variety of clientele. Strong knowledge of psychotherapeutic modalities including c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), psychodynamic therapy, trauma-focused therapy, and behavior management techniques. Familiarity with ICD coding systems (ICD-9/ICD-10) for accurate diagnosis documentation. Experience working with co-occurring disorders such as mental health conditions combined with substance use or chronic pain issues. Proficiency in clinical documentation standards, medical terminology, telehealth platforms, and EMR/EHR systems. Excellent communication skills for patient assessment and client engagement; ability to handle crisis situations with professionalism and empathy. Knowledge of HIPAA compliance and clinical ethical guidelines ensuring confidentiality and patient rights are maintained at all times.
